Prerequisites
Basics of stoichiometry, chemical bonding, chemical equilibrium and kinetic theory of perfect gases.
Integration of simple differential equations
Kinetics and Combustion 1. Basics of qualitative basic fluid mechanics.

Course content
1. Within the combustion kinetics branched

a) Reminder: the kinetics of reactions branched; example: the combustion of hydrogen
b) Thermochemistry of combustion runaway
c) Classification, vocabulary combustion: premixed flames, diffusion, laminar, turbulent notion of wealth

2. The inflammation theory

a) Theory Semenov: Prediction of critical ignition temperatures
b) Flash Charts: Evolution of inflammation limits with temperature and pressure
c) Limitations of self-ignition gas medium: Notion explosive mixture, flash points etc?
d) Theory of detonation-Jouguet Chapman: Both regimes spread of a premixed flame?

3. combustion Mechanisms

a) Combustion of Gas: synthesis gas Butane
b) Liquid Combustion: fuels
c) solid combustion: Explosives, dispersed solids?

4. Combustion Technology

a) Internal combustion engines: gasoline engine - Diesel? HCCI. Pollutant formation
b) Reactors
c) Rocket engines
d) accidental Combustions
